There is a significant gap in the cost of living between these two cities. Kings Mountain is 27.1% cheaper than Swansboro. With a cost index of 75 vs 103, the difference would have a meaningful impact on a household's monthly budget. Someone relocating from Kings Mountain to Swansboro should plan for substantially higher expenses across most categories.

On the housing front, median rent in Kings Mountain is $879/month compared to $1,380/month in Swansboro — a 36% difference. Home values follow the same pattern: Kings Mountain is more affordable at $177,700 median vs $356,900.

Median household income in Kings Mountain is $45,507 compared to $112,382 in Swansboro (-59.5%). While Swansboro is more expensive, its higher salaries more than compensate — residents there may actually end up with more disposable income. Looking at affordability, residents of Kings Mountain spend roughly 23.2% of their income on rent, more than the 14.7% in Swansboro.
